Indications Your Windows Requirement Repair or Replacement
When reviewing the condition of windows, property owners should try to find noticeable damages indications such as fractures or bending. Furthermore, relentless drafts and obvious energy loss can indicate the requirement for repair work or substitute. Dealing with these issues immediately can enhance convenience and enhance energy effectiveness.
Noticeable Damage Indicators
Windows offer as both useful elements and visual features of a home, but noticeable damage can indicate the demand for repair or replacement. Property owners should be alert for several indications, such as cracks in the glass, which jeopardize insulation and security. Warping or rotting frames can bring about architectural concerns and lowered performance. Furthermore, peeling off paint or rust on metal elements may recommend moisture damage and deterioration. Broken or loose equipment can hinder home window operation, posing safety risks (Replacement Windows). Notably, condensation in between glass panes shows seal failing, demanding prompt attention. Recognizing these noticeable damages signs is necessary, as timely treatment can protect against further issues and boost the home's overall energy effectiveness and charm
Drafts and Power Loss
A noticeable draft can be a clear indicator that home windows require repair or substitute. Homeowners frequently overlook the refined indicators of air leak, which can significantly affect power effectiveness. Drafts not only jeopardize convenience but likewise bring about increased heating & cooling expenses. When home windows fall short to secure effectively, conditioned air runs away, triggering a/c systems to function more challenging. Indications of drafts might include spaces around the window frame, condensation in between panes, or visible temperature level differences near the windows. Regular assessments can aid recognize these issues early. Resolving drafts without delay via expert fixing or substitute solutions can improve a home's energy efficiency, minimize energy expenses, and boost overall convenience, guaranteeing a more pleasurable living atmosphere.

The Home Window Installment Refine: What to Expect
They can expect a distinct process that generally unravels in several key stages when house owners determine to set up brand-new home windows. At first, a consultation with a home window professional happens, enabling homeowners to discuss their choices, budget, and particular demands. Following this, the specialist carries out an on-site dimension to guarantee the brand-new windows will certainly fit completely.
Next, house owners choose the home window design and materials, thinking about factors such as toughness and aesthetic appeals. Once choices are made, the professional schedules an installation date.
On the day of installation, the group prepares the website, removes old home windows, and very carefully mounts the brand-new ones. This procedure consists of sealing and shielding to guarantee appropriate fit and feature. A complete cleaning is performed, and homeowners are enlightened on maintenance and treatment. With this structured technique, homeowners can anticipate a smooth changeover to their brand-new home windows.

Choosing the Right Window Style for Your Home
How can property owners choose the perfect home window design that complements both their useful demands and aesthetic preferences? They must think about the building design of their home. Typical homes frequently fit casement or double-hung home windows, while modern-day layouts might gain from smooth picture or slider home windows. Next, performance plays a substantial duty; as an example, home owners in regions with high winds could choose impact-resistant home windows, while those looking for the ideal ventilation might favor awning or hopper windows.
Power efficiency is an additional crucial variable. Choosing home windows with ideal glazing can boost insulation, reducing power prices. Additionally, house owners must assume regarding structure products-- vinyl, wood, and fiberglass each deal distinctive benefits regarding maintenance and appearance. Finally, personal design can not be forgotten; shape, color, and grid patterns must harmonize with the home's overall design. By thoroughly evaluating these aspects, house owners can accomplish an excellent equilibrium in between form and feature.

Keeping Your Windows for Long-Lasting Efficiency
Normal maintenance is essential for house owners intending to ensure the resilient performance of their home windows. This includes regular cleansing, which avoids dirt and gunk buildup that can result in damage. Property owners should check home window frames and seals for any kind of indicators of wear or wear and tear, addressing problems quickly to avoid expensive repair services. Lubing moving parts, such as locks and copyrights, is essential to secure smooth operation and enhance safety.
In addition, inspecting for condensation between double-pane home windows can indicate seal failing, requiring specialist attention. Homeowners must also think about seasonal examinations, especially prior to extreme weather events, to ensure windows continue to be energy-efficient and useful. Appropriately maintaining windows not just expands their life yet also contributes to enhanced energy performance, lowering heating & cooling expenses. By devoting to regular upkeep, property owners can delight in the benefits of properly maintained home windows, improving both the useful and aesthetic elements of their homes.

What Are the Expenses Related To Home Window Fixing Versus Replacement?
Costs for home window fixing commonly range from $100 to $500, depending upon damage severity, while substitute can range from $300 to $1,000 per window, affected by variables such as material, installment, and dimension complexity.
